For more than six decades, the legendary prima of Bulgarian pop music, Lili Ivanova, has continued to attract thousands of fans to her concerts both in Bulgaria and abroad. In May, she began her national tour at the Ivan Vazov National Theatre in Sofia, performing alongside the orchestra of the National Musical Theatre “Stefan Makedonski”, conductor Konstantin Dobroykov, and the musicians of LI ORCHESTRA.

The tour will conclude on December 12 and 13 at Hall No 1 of the National Palace of Culture in Sofia. This year’s program includes around ten contemporary music hits, three of Lili Ivanova’s most beloved songs— “Shturche” (Cricket), “Detelini” (Clovers) and “Vetrove” (Winds), along with the iconic “Kamino” and “Prisada”, with which Lili Ivanova traditionally closes her concerts in recent years.

On Lili Ivanova’s initiative, the eponymous foundation will celebrate the 100th birth anniversary of the legendary Bulgarian actor Georgi Partsalev with a large-scale performance on December 14—again at Hall 1 of the National Palace of Culture. The event will feature a special appearance by Lili Ivanova and her LI ORCHESTRA, alongside the entire troupe of the Satirical Theatre ‘Aleko Konstantinov’, where Georgi Partsalev performed for 32 seasons.

Looking ahead to a new record in the New Year

 

On May 24, 2026, the incredible Lili Ivanova will take the stage at Paris’s Olympia Hall for the second time in her career. Back in 2009, she became the first Bulgarian to give a solo concert at the historic venue. Seventeen years later, Lili Ivanova will be the first and only Bulgarian artist to have two solo performances in the heart of Paris. This is a worldwide precedent, especially for an artist from Eastern Europe. The Bulgarian star sets yet another impressive record in her remarkable career.
